<p><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Gordon Lownds's career was peaking. He was fearless. Invincible.</span></p><p></p><p><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>But fate-and cocaine-intervened.</span></p><p></p><p><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>A reckless experimental hit on a crack pipe quickly morphed into a raging hard-core shooting-up junkie experience. He became trapped in unfamiliar territory desperately trying to navigate the sordid violent drug world-all while coping with a psychotic girlfriend overdoses and drug busts.</span></p><p></p><p><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Lownds barely survived the soul-destroying and death-defying events that unfolded over just 1000 days. But he managed to crawl out of the gutters of despair-only to find even greater trials ahead in recovery. It took many hard years for him to earn back the respect he'd once had and the trust of those he'd let down.</span></p><p></p><p><em style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Cracking Up</em><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)> reveals the darkest side of success and the hidden struggles faced by a distinguished Canadian entrepreneur. It's a brutally honest account of how even the most successful can fall and of the universal challenges faced by all addicts trying to reclaim their lives.</span></p>
